According to the Mayo Clinic, laughter has both short-term and long-term benefits. Short-term, the physiological changes your body goes through when you laugh – stretching muscles, increasing oxygen flow and stimulating circulation – can soothe tension. Long-term, laughter may boost your immune system and may even relieve pain.

For right now, though, it might be the mental break you need to help you refocus.
